Terms and Conditions of Subscription to the Instant Payment Scheme "WAMD"

These terms and conditions apply to and regulate customers' registration and use of the instant fund payment platform using the money transfer and receiving service known as "WAMD" within the scope of participating local banks licensed by the Central Bank of Kuwait.

"WAMD" is a service provided by the Shared Electronic Banking Services Company (the "Operator") to (local) banks, which in turn provide this service to their customers.

The service enables bank customers to send and/or receive money between participating accounts electronically using the customer's mobile phone, via the internet.

The Bank seeks to enable its customers who wish to benefit from the "WAMD" instant money payment service by enabling registration/enrollment to use the service through the Bank's electronic platform.

After the customer successfully registers/enrolls their account on the electronic platform, they only need to authorize each transaction on the platform using one of the biometrics (such as face print, fingerprint, voice, IRIS, or any other unique means of customer identification).

  • Any fund transfer made by the customer (sending/receiving money) into the account must be in Kuwaiti Dinars (KWD) only.
  • The minimum transaction value is KWD 1, and the maximum transaction value is KWD 1,000.
  • The daily maximum transaction limit is KWD 3,000.
  • The monthly maximum transaction limit is KWD 20,000.
  • If the customer exceeds any specified maximum limit, the transaction will be rejected.
